AbstractPublished data on Indian Refractory materials are meagre and are principally confined to chemical analysis. Physical data have not been readily available so far, as prior to the establishment of the Refractories Research and Testing Laboratory at Jamshedpur, by the Tata Iron & Steel Co. about ten years ago, no fully equipped laboratory for refractories study existed in India. Some of the data collected in this laboratory on Indian refractory materials are presented here. Data on corresponding foreign materials are also included.
